A professional guide with expertise in natural history accompanies the group. After a safety briefing and paddle instruction, participants launch from La Jolla Shores beach. The route includes paddling along the coastline to explore the La Jolla Sea Caves and surrounding ecological reserve. The guide points out local wildlife such as sea lions, seals, dolphins, and occasionally gray whales. Paddlers may pass through kelp forests and rock formations, weather and ocean conditions permitting. The tour finishes with a kayak surf ride back to the beach. Life jackets are provided, and wetsuit rentals are available during fall, winter, and spring. Participants should expect to get wet and must be able to swim. The tour does not guarantee entry into the caves, as this depends on safety, ocean conditions, and ability as assessed by the guide. Children aged 6 and older can join but must share the kayak with an adult over 18.
